This book introduces learners to the fundamental concepts of strategic management of a small business, in the context of increasing globalisation. The text is designed to provide learners with the tools to analyse, formulate and implement strategies that will enhance the performance of any small business.

Professor Cecile Nieuwenhuizen is the Head of Department: Business Management in the Faculty of Management at the University of Johannesburg. She is well known in the Entrepreneurship environment and is the series editor of the Entrepreneurship Series and other Entrepreneurship books. She has also published in the areas of Business Management and Marketing.
